Contact Import
Import or update multiple contacts into the platform via the import process. 

Contacts > Import > Contacts:

Download the arkflux excel spreadsheet to populate your data. 
Screenshot2022-03-12at19.08.47.png
Note: You can use your own excel spreadsheet to import into the platform, but you will not get the benefit of the telephone formatter (see further below).
Screenshot2021-08-30at13.01.57.png
Once you have populated the spreadsheet, click here in blue to upload.
Lead Source data entry
Update the options available to enter into the Lead Source column within the spreadsheet.

There are three ways the Lead Source field can be populated:

  • Via a marketing automation where the status will show the name of the campaign - e.g Website Live Demo request.
  • Manually where you will select the status from the pre defined dropdown under CRM Settings.
  • Via a contact import, supported by the pre defined dropdown under CRM Settings.

If there is an existing lead source in place generated from a marketing automation or manual entry, when a contact import is done, the lead source will not be updated to preserve the origin of the contact. 
Update the Lead Source via Import

Admin > CRM Settings:
Picture101234567891011121314151617.png
Once defined, type these options in the relevant columns in the import spreadsheet exactly as they appear. If the entries in the spreadsheet are not identical to the entries in the import spreadsheet, they will not import. This is because if the Lead Source is 'Networking Cambridge' you don't want that cluttering up the options in the settings.

The fields on your spreadsheet are referenced as Source Columns and the fields that they need to map to in the platform are know as Target Fields. Upon importation, any of the Source Column fields that match the Target Fields will be automatically matched and accompanied by a green dot. It's always worth double checking these before moving on. 

Any other fields that show a red dot have not been mapped and can be mapped manually, by selecting the correct Target Field from the corresponding dropdown.

You do not have to map every field - the only mandatory field in a contact import is the email address of the contact. If you want to link a contact to a company, you will have to map the company field during this process.

Note: When mapping an Attribute field that is a Checkbox, if you need to import multiple values, separate the values with a semi colon in the same column on the excel import spreadsheet e.g. Field values equal Cat;Bird;Dog
[Custom Fields] Select these to map to custom fields you have created in the platform.
[Attribute Fields] Select these to map to attribute fields you have created in the platform.

As the platform offers the option for SMS campaigns, all phone numbers - mobile and landline - will need to be entered in their international format (+44 / 44).

Ensure the Mobile and Telephone columns are set as Text by highlighting the column > right click > Format Cells > Text > OK:
Picture1.png
Identify if the number you need to format is UK, USA or Canadian > right click on the cell with the number in it > Telephone Formatter > select Country. You can do more than one number at a time if they are all the same Country. The phone number will turn blue if the format doesn’t appear to match the standard country format:

All contact details can be updated apart from the email address because the platform is email centric and all actions and data is linked. If you need to update an email address, create it as new and put a note on the retired email address to redirect Users to the new one. If you know you are not going to use the email again, unsubscribe it for clarity.

Via the Import

If you need to update multiple contacts, export all contact details via Contacts > Contacts > Export All button at the top of the page and make the necessary updates. Once the spreadsheet is updated, reimport the spreadsheet via Contacts > Import > Contacts. Any changes will then be added to the relevant contacts without duplication.

Manually

Contacts > Contacts > Click on the contact you want to update via the edit pen icon next to the area you want to change.
Note: Lists are not currently included in the full Contact Export All process. There is the option to export via specified lists through Contacts > List.
